Unexpected expenses during pool and spa service often stem from sinkhole or soil subsidence repairs beneath cracked decks. You will also encounter recurring charges for phosphate treatments to combat algae fueled by heavy organic debris in Orlando. Storm damage frequently requires unbudgeted screen enclosure repairs. Additionally, removing severe calcium scaling from hard water and upgrading electrical systems to meet current safety codes create surprise financial impacts.

The ideal time to schedule pool construction and installation is late fall through early spring. During this dry season in Orlando, soil conditions remain stable and avoid frequent summer rain delays. Start the permitting process by January to ensure completion by summer. Evaluate your property for new drainage issues after hurricane season, and align your project timeline with your local HOA approval cycles.

Hire local professionals with active state-level certifications for pool construction and installation. Verify that they use properly licensed subcontractors for all electrical and plumbing work. Your contractor must understand FL building codes regarding safety barriers and wind loads. Ask for local references to confirm their experience managing the sandy soils, high water tables, and strict HOA approval processes common throughout the Orlando area.

Schedule pool and spa service when you spot cloudy or green water, as Orlando's intense heat accelerates algae growth. Heavy rains and tropical storms introduce debris and dilute chemicals, making post-storm inspections essential. Check for clogged filters during pollen or love bug seasons. Address any damaged safety fences immediately to keep your property secure. A local professional will restore your water chemistry and ensure your equipment functions perfectly.

When planning pool construction and installation, prepare for separate building, electrical, and plumbing permits. Upgrading safety barriers to meet strict FL requirements adds expense. Excavating in Orlando neighborhoods with mature trees requires root removal or utility rerouting. High water tables demand special dewatering equipment. You will also face post-construction expenses for mandatory screen enclosures, professional turf resodding, and local utility connection fees.
